Why is the resurrection of Christ vital for believers?
Answered in 1 source
The resurrection of Christ is vital as it assures us of our own resurrection and victory over sin and death.
The resurrection of Christ is the cornerstone of Christian faith, affirming that He has triumphed over sin and death. According to Scripture, His resurrection guarantees the future resurrection of all who are in Him, ensuring that believers will be transformed and given glorified bodies free from sin. This victory not only provides hope but also serves as confirmation of the promises of God regarding the redemption of His people. In Philippians 3:20-21, believers are reminded that their citizenship is in heaven where they await a Savior who will transform them to be like Him, thereby emphasizing the promise of resurrection and eternal life. Therefore, the resurrection is not simply an event in history but a central aspect of the believer’s assurance and hope.
